MarketAxess Holdings Inc., together with its subsidiaries, operates an electronic trading platform for institutional investor and broker-dealer companies worldwide. MarketAxess Holdings Inc. was incorporated in 2000 and is headquartered in New York, New York. Marketaxess Holdings operates under Capital Markets classification in the United States and is traded on NASDAQ Exchange. It employs 732 people. Market capitalization and book value offer complementary views of MarketAxess Holdings — the first driven by investor sentiment, the second by accounting standards. MarketAxess Holdings' market capitalization is 6.7 B. With a P/B ratio of 5.63, the market values MarketAxess Holdings well above its book equity. Enterprise value stands at 6.22 B. Intrinsic value represents an estimate of underlying worth and can differ from both market price and book value. Valuation methods compare these perspectives to frame context.
Value and price for MarketAxess Holdings are related but not identical, and they can diverge across cycles. For MarketAxess Holdings, key inputs include a P/E ratio of 32.01, a P/B ratio of 5.63, a profit margin of 29.14%, and ROE of 19.39%. By contrast, market price reflects the level where buyers and sellers transact.
